Chlorophytum comosum, commonly known as the spider plant, is a popular and easy-to-grow houseplant with long, arching leaves that produce small plantlets or spiderettes at the ends of long stems. Here are some tips for caring for your Chlorophytum Irish:

  1. Light: Chlorophytum Irish prefers bright, indirect light, but can also tolerate low light conditions.

  2. Water: Chlorophytum Irish prefers to be kept slightly moist, but not waterlogged. Water the plant when the top inch of soil feels dry.

  3. Humidity: Chlorophytum Irish does well in average household humidity levels.

  4. Temperature: Chlorophytum Irish prefers temperatures between 60-75°F (15-24°C).

  5. Soil: Chlorophytum Irish prefers well-draining soil that is rich in organic matter.

  6. Fertilizer: Feed your Chlorophytum Irish with a balanced fertilizer every 4-6 weeks during the growing season (spring and summer). Do not fertilize during the winter months.

  7. Pruning: Prune your Chlorophytum Irish to maintain its shape and remove any yellowing or damaged leaves.

  8. Propagation: Chlorophytum Irish can be propagated by division or by planting the spiderettes that form at the end of its long stems.

  9. Toxicity: Chlorophytum Irish is non-toxic to pets and humans.

By following these tips, you can help your Chlorophytum Irish thrive and enjoy its beautiful foliage in your home or office.
